              • kelle-yess asks about giving upward feedback to senior designers, and how to deal with resulting pushback. Good questions abound. A tl;dl of our advice:
                • Consider a matrix of the following
                  • The person giving the feedback and receiving the feedback
                  • The type of feedback, stage of product, fidelity of feedback, location of feedback
                  • The Socratic method is a useful way to approach a conversation with good intent and having the intention to learn along the way.
                  • Compromise and pick your battles. Losing in public gives you social capital. Figure out where you rank on the sliding scale of giving a fuck.
                  • It's possible that you don't know everything about the situation, or the person you're giving feedback to is shielding you from unnecessary context.
                  • Sometimes egos get in the way. But they're worth considering. Giving feedback in private, or in a way that lets your senior save-face, might be a better strategy and strengthen your relationship.
                  • Also, sometimes people suck. Peer feedback and manager escalation are valid paths in particularly sticky situations.
